Fei Comodo

Fei Comodo are an Essex hardcore/metalcore/post-hardcore band. They are due to release a mini-album titled "They All Have Two Faces" this September and they are know signed to Small Town Records. They are partly known as doing the theme song for 'Mighty Moshing Emo Rangers'. In September 07, Fei toured in support for fellow Essex band InMe. Members are:
Marc Halls - Vocals
Rob Clemson - Drums
Jay Styler - Bass
Mike Curtis - Guitar

Bury Tomorrow

5-piece Southcoast Metalcore BURY TOMORROW play a collision course combination of both agressive and melodic metal, complimented by an intense live show.
Thier debut CD 'The Sleep Of The Innocents' is out now, you can pick it up from thier webstore or a show.

A Day to Remember

It would be almost too easy and obvious to describe A Day To Remember as the creators of one of the unforgettable rock albums of 2007, but that wouldn’t make it any less true. Hailing from Ocala, Florida, the five members of A Day To Remember have crafted a unique blend of what can best be called “pop-mosh" Their newest album, one of AP's most anticipated albums of '09, "Homesick" was released on February 3rd 2009.

We Are The Ocean

We Are The Ocean are a lively five piece rock band based in Loughton, Essex.
The band consists of five members - Dan, Liam, Alfie, Jack and Tom.
They formed in December 2005 under the name Dead But Still Dreaming, but have since renamed themselves in Febuary 2007. They since toured with such bands as Fightstar, You Me At Six, The Blackout, Paige and Furthest Drive Home
They released their debut EP in August.
Their debut full-length album is due in 2009.

Shadows Chasing Ghosts

SHADOWS CHASING GHOSTS were formed in 2007 with Trey Tremain (Vocals), Danny Coy (Drums), Matt Jones (Guitar), Danny Green (Bass) and Rich Jones (Guitar). In December of '07 SCG hit Outhouse studios (Enter Shikari, Architects, You Me At Six) and recorded their first 7 song EP (Never get a wolfs attention by pulling its tail) Since then they have been constantly touring bringing with them their explosive and unexpected stage presence and with their mix of razor sharp guitar work, body popping dance moves and sing along melodies.

Funeral Hag

Funeral Hag are a Brighton, UK/Worthing, UK based band playing down-tempo, heavy music in a sludgecore/stoner/doom vein. The band started as a solo project of guitarist Jon Hill (ex-Killing Mode, ex-Misery) in 2008, but he decided to take the band further and began recruiting members. It is now the beginning of 2009 and those band members have been found. Flood of Red

Flood of Red are a 6 piece musical outfit from Glasgow, Scotland. They started in 2004 playing 'Post-Hardcore' music but now describe themselves as 'Big and Loud' with more focus and thought on melody and songwriting. They released an EP in early 2007 which was their first ever release. This received critical acclaim from several publications in the United Kingdom. Following this release the band encountered varying problems from within the music industry and decided to concentrate on their music and bringing their live performances to fans all across the country...
